In the Photo Mode,the System will show the thumbnail Mode first.

,

,

,

,

:select and play.

Slide Show:play the JPEG.
Menu:Enter the Help Menu.
Prev:Page Up.
Next:Page Down.

Note:
If you want to return to the Main Menu,please make sure the system is 

in the list or file of 

the folder, then press the "RETURN" key.

After selecting the desired option (USB or SD/MMC) the system shows the Main Menu 
for the option selected which include 4 function icons. You can select any of the icons 
using the "           “ keys and press "ENTER" to confirm.
